i have a mavic air 2 it stops filming and restarts after 4 mins of flying is that normal so if i fly for 13 mins its going to have 3 seperate videos on the sd card when i look at sd card after flight is there a setting to make it film as long as the flight is or do you have to get an editing progam to dub it together to make one video
 
Like many other cameras, DJI drones have a file size limit of approx 4 GB.
This is normal.
You can have a longer continuous video by shooting at a lower resolution which will reduce the file size.

Plenty of free video editors can compile the 4K video segments into a single 4K video. YouTube might even still be able to do so, too! That's what I started with on the P3P, originally, before upgrading to Premier Pro.
 
The files are temporally contiguous, and can be seamlessly joined together.

The problem lies with DJI’s assumption that it has to support the Microsoft FAT file format. This format limits any file‘s length to 4096 mB.

is this the same way with the mavic 2 zoom and mavic 2 pro .... and what editing program do you reccommend to join together .... thanks for your reply
 
I haven’t tried all the drones, but the P4 adv, the MA, and P34K all behave that way. I doubt that any don’t. DJI would need to modify the component of their software that writes files to change this.

Both Final Cut Pro X and Resolve handle this fine - you just end up with a shot that is made up of multiple pieces.
